1. Introduction to Mobile Art Apps: Evolution and Significance
a. Definition and scope of mobile art applications
Mobile art applications are software tools designed for smartphones and tablets that enable users to create, edit, and share digital artworks. Their scope ranges from simple sketching and coloring to advanced layers, animation, and even 3D modeling. These apps cater to a broad audience, including beginners, hobbyists, and professional artists, blurring traditional boundaries of art creation.
b. Historical overview: From early drawing tools to sophisticated design platforms
The journey of mobile art apps traces back to basic drawing utilities on early smartphones, such as simple paint programs. Over time, technological advancements introduced multi-touch screens, pressure-sensitive styluses, and high-resolution displays, fostering sophisticated platforms like Autodesk SketchBook and Adobe Photoshop Sketch. These developments mirror a broader evolution from rudimentary tools to professional-grade design environments, democratizing creativity across the globe.

3. Technological Advancements Enabling Modern Mobile Art
a. Hardware innovations (stylus support, high-resolution screens)
The advent of pressure-sensitive styluses like Apple Pencil and high-resolution, color-accurate screens has significantly enhanced mobile art experiences. These hardware features provide precision and nuance comparable to traditional tools, allowing artists to create detailed and expressive works directly on their devices.
b. Software developments (AI-assisted tools, multi-layer editing)
Modern apps incorporate artificial intelligence to automate tasks like colorization, sketch prediction, and noise reduction, boosting productivity and creativity. Multi-layer editing, akin to desktop applications, enables complex compositions and corrections, elevating mobile art to professional standards.
c. Integration of cloud storage and sharing features for collaborative learning
Cloud integration allows artists to save, access, and share their works seamlessly across devices. Collaborative features foster peer review, group projects, and mentorship opportunities, vital for educational growth and community building.

7. Accessibility, Inclusivity, and Ethical Considerations
a. How mobile art apps cater to diverse populations, including differently-abled users
Features like voice commands, customizable controls, and screen readers enhance accessibility. For instance, apps integrating haptic feedback assist users with visual impairments, ensuring inclusive participation in digital art creation.
b. Challenges related to digital divide and device limitations
Despite broad availability, disparities in device quality and internet access limit some populations. Addressing these challenges involves optimizing apps for low-spec devices and providing offline functionality where possible.
c. Ethical issues: Intellectual property, AI-generated art, and geo-restrictions
Concerns around AI-generated art raise questions about originality and authorship. Additionally, geo-restrictions can limit access to certain features or content, affecting global inclusivity. Ethical use and clear policies are vital for responsible platform development.
